## Deployment

Tollgate's integration tests are flaky in CI, mostly timeouts against the sandbox ledger. Deploys are gated on two green runs, not one, until the retry fix lands. Quarantined tests are listed in the suite manifest. Deploys go out Tuesdays. The service currently runs with the configuration below.

service settings:
PRAIX_LOG_LEVEL=error
PRAIX_METRICS_HOST=metrics.praix.qorvelcorp.corp
PRAIX_POOL_SIZE=16

// Fixture: vendored_fonts_manifest.json
// This fixture mirrors the production manifest for fonts vendored
// from the Quillcast foundry into the Lanternmade build. Support:
// if a customer reports missing glyphs, compare their manifest hash
// against this fixture before escalating. The fetch script pulls
// from our internal mirror only, never the foundry directly.
// Requests to the mirror must present the bearer token below.

session JWT of yawep-yawep = eyJhbGciOiJIUzI1NiIsInR5cCI6IkpXVCJ9.eyJzdWIiOiI3pWF3_In0.aXYsHiog

Several external plugin authors have reported that uploads to the SproutCycle scheduler marketplace fail with SIGNATURE_MISMATCH since the 3.2 rollout. Investigation shows our verifier now requires manifests signed against the updated trust root, while older tooling still references the retired chain. Please re-sign your plugin bundles before resubmitting; unsigned or legacy-signed packages will be rejected automatically. For convenience during the transition, the current marketplace signing key is included below.

signing key of fajof-tagag = bky3_rJk